site stats

Binary and linear search difference

WebIn linear search, sequential access of the elements is done. On the other hand, in the binary search process – random elements are accessed while performing search … WebDefinition: Linear search, also called as orderly search or sequential search, because each crucial element is searched from the first element in an array, i.e. a [0] to final element in an array, i.e. a [n-1]. It assesses each element of the list without jumping before a match is found or the entire list was searched.

Linear Search vs Binary Search - GeeksforGeeks

WebNov 14, 2011 · Binary search works for strings or numbers as long as they are stored in sorted order. The primary idea behind Binary search is that it is based on examining the middle element. Interpolation search is a variant. Instead of using the exact middle element it guesses where the next element to compare with passed value is. WebYou probably already have an intuitive idea that binary search makes fewer guesses than linear search. You even might have perceived that the difference between the worst-case number of guesses for linear search and binary search becomes more striking as the array length increases. Let's see how to analyze the maximum number of guesses that ... dark chocolate has magnesium https://eliastrutture.com

Linear vs Binary Search: Data Structure - TAE - Tutorial And …

WebDec 23, 2024 · Linear search and binary search are two algorithms for searching an object in a data structure similar to a program. Binary search works better and faster than line search, but it is mandatory to filter the … WebFeb 19, 2014 · 2 Answers. Sorted by: 2. You're mixing up sort and search algorithms. Linear search and binary search are algorithms for finding a value in an array, not sorting the array. Insertion sort and mergesort are sorting algorithms. Insertion sort tends run faster for small arrays. Many high-performance sorting routines, including Python's adaptive ... WebMar 24, 2024 · Difference Between Linear Search and Binary Search - In this post, we will understand the difference between Linear Search and Binary Search.Linear SearchIt … dark chocolate have milk

Linear Search vs Binary Search - Medium

Category:Explain the difference between binary search and linear search.

Tags:Binary and linear search difference

Binary and linear search difference

Linear Search vs Binary Search - GeeksforGeeks

WebYou probably already have an intuitive idea that binary search makes fewer guesses than linear search. You even might have perceived that the difference between the worst … WebMar 30, 2009 · A linear search looks down a list, one item at a time, without jumping. In complexity terms this is an O(n) search - the time taken to search the list gets bigger at …

Binary and linear search difference

Did you know?

WebAnswer. Linear Search. Binary Search. Linear search works on sorted and unsorted arrays. Binary search works only on sorted arrays (both ascending and descending). … WebSep 30, 2024 · The space complexity in binary search is denoted by O (1). Binary search is more optimized than linear search, but the array must be sorted to apply binary …

WebApr 3, 2024 · Differences Between Binary Search and Linear Search. Prerequisites: Binary search requires the input array to be sorted, whereas linear search can work on … WebApr 3, 2024 · Differences Between Binary Search and Linear Search. Prerequisites: Binary search requires the input array to be sorted, whereas linear search can work on both sorted and unsorted arrays. Efficiency: Binary search is more efficient than linear search, especially for large datasets. Binary search has a time complexity of O(log n), …

WebLinear search vs Binary search. This video explains the 3 basic and the most important differences between the linear search and binary search along with the differences in … WebBinarySearch • Quickly#find#an#item#(val)#in#a sorted#list.# • Procedure: 1. Init min#and#max#variables#to#lowestand#highestindex# 2. Repeatwhile# min#≤#max a. Compare#item#atthe# middleindex#with#thatbeing#sought(val) b. If#item#at middleequals#val,#return#middle# c.

WebLinear search is iterative in nature and uses sequential approach. On the other hand, Binary search implements divide and conquer approach. The time complexity of linear search is O (N) while binary search has O …

WebApr 15, 2024 · Linear search has a time complexity of O (N) Binary search has a time complexity of O (log 2 n) Linear search can be implemented on single linked list, double … bise lahore 1 year result 2022 gazetteWebIn a linear search, the elements are accessed sequentially, whereas; in binary search, the elements are accessed randomly. There is no need to sort data in a linear search while in binary search, the elements need … bise lahore 11th class date sheet 2022W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ial. dark chocolate hazelnut coffee carbWeb8 rows · Mar 30, 2024 · Important Differences. Linear Search. Binary Search. In linear search input data need ...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… bise lahore 9th roll number slip 2017WebApr 12, 2024 · The study was specifically designed to compare and explain sets of binary classification models based upon these algorithms for distinguishing between different combinations of compound activity ... dark chocolate have leadWebMay 14, 2024 · Compared to linear search, binary search is known to be a much faster approach to searching. While linear search would go through each element one by one, … bise lahore attestationWebAdvantages: Binary search has a temporal complexity of O (log n), which is much quicker than linear search for big arrays (O (n)). Binary search is excellent for huge datasets because it can rapidly restrict the search region, making it more efficient than linear search. Binary search is more efficient for sorted data because it may rapidly ... bise lahore 2020 intermediate